Pulling out like terms :

4.1     Pull out like factors :

 -2x3 - 4x2 - 6x  =   -2x • (x2 + 2x + 3)

Trying to factor by splitting the middle term

4.2     Factoring  x2 + 2x + 3

The first term is,  x2  its coefficient is  1 .

The middle term is,  +2x  its coefficient is  2 .

The last term, "the constant", is  +3

Step-1 : Multiply the coefficient of the first term by the constant   1 • 3 = 3

Step-2 : Find two factors of  3  whose sum equals the coefficient of the middle term, which is   2 .

    -3    +    -1    =    -4

    -1    +    -3    =    -4

    1    +    3    =    4

    3    +    1    =    4

Observation : No two such factors can be found !!

Conclusion : Trinomial can not be factored

Final result :

-2x • (x2 + 2x + 3)
